<p>A protester in London dressed like President Donald Trump in a gorilla costume behind bars on July 13 during the president’s visit to the UK.</p><p>Tens of thousands</a> of protesters took to the streets during the second day of Trump’s visit, during which he had tea with Queen Elizabeth II at Windsor Castle.</p><p>This video shows the protester who dressed like Trump in a gorilla costume as he posed for pictures from the cage.</p><p>This idea mimics a stunt from August 2016 when the Kremlin paid a Trump supporter to build a cage and dress as Hillary Clinton. This was part of a scheme run by the Internet Research Agency from St Petersburg, Russia, to undermine the American political system, according to CNN</a>.</p><p>The London protests included</a> organized marches and “Trump baby,” a giant balloon that mimicked Trump as a screaming orange baby.</p><p>Trump met with Prime Minister Theresa May earlier during his trip for talks on trade, Brexit and NATO, according to local news reports</a>. The president was expected</a> to stay the weekend in Scotland at his Turnberry golf property. Credit: Dub Chain via Storyful</p><br />
